No. 2206 R E S O L U T I O N WHEREAS, Alaina Colleen Dixon has distinguished herself in her responsibilities as an administrative aide and Texas Legislative Internship Program Fellow in the office of State Representative Venton Jones during the 88th Legislative Session; and WHEREAS, Since joining the staff, Ms. Dixon has provided vital assistance in handling a wide variety of challenging tasks; she has been particularly passionate about such critical issues as living wages for working families, public health, and civic engagement, and she has also thoughtfully managed meetings with constituents, elected officials, and advocacy organizations; and WHEREAS, Ms. Dixon attends Southwestern University, where she studies political science, and she is a recognized Texas Civic Ambassador; she previously completed internships with Prosper Georgetown and the San Antonio Food Bank, and she is a member of the Pi Sigma Alpha National Political Science Honor Society and the Alpha Chi National College Honor Society; and WHEREAS, Alaina Dixon has performed her duties as an administrative aide and TLIP Fellow with skill and dedication, and she is indeed deserving of special recognition for her fine work;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 88th Texas Legislature hereby commend Alaina Colleen Dixon for her service as an administrative aide and Texas Legislative Internship Program Fellow in the office of State Representative Venton Jones and extend to her sincere best wishes for continued success in all her endeavors; and, be it further R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be prepared for Ms. Dixon as an expression of high regard by the Texas House of Representatives.
